Gold Leaf Restoration and Conservation
Existing gilded surfaces can deteriorate over time through age, handling, environmental exposure, previous repairs or inappropriate cleaning. Restoration requires more than simply applying new gold leaf over an existing finish.
Gilding Specialist carefully assesses the condition of the surface before determining the most suitable restoration approach. Where appropriate, damaged areas can be stabilised, prepared and re-gilded while preserving sound original work.
Historic gilding requires particular sensitivity. The objective is not necessarily to make an old surface look completely new, but to restore its visual integrity while respecting its age, character and original craftsmanship.
Specialist gilders working on historic projects may use traditional techniques such as water gilding, oil or mordant gilding, depending on the surface and intended result.

Exterior Gold Leaf Gilding
Exterior gilding presents different technical challenges from interior work. Surfaces must be properly prepared to withstand weather, moisture, temperature changes and other environmental conditions.
Exterior architectural gilding can be used for domes, cupolas, sculptures, finials, signage and other prominent decorative features. Correct preparation and an appropriate gilding system are essential to achieving a finish that performs well in its intended environment.

Genuine Gold Leaf Finishes
Genuine gold leaf provides a depth and luminosity that is difficult to reproduce with conventional metallic paint. The extremely thin sheets of gold catch and reflect light differently as the viewing angle changes, giving gilded surfaces their distinctive character.
Different karats and shades of gold can be selected according to the project. Genuine gold leaf is available in a range of colours and compositions, allowing the finish to complement both traditional and modern interiors.
For specialist restoration projects, the correct gold leaf can also be selected to harmonise with surviving original gilding.

The Gold Leaf Gilding Process
A successful gilding project begins well before the first sheet of gold leaf is applied.
Surface Assessment
The existing surface is examined to determine its condition, construction and suitability for gilding.
Preparation
The surface is cleaned, repaired and prepared as required. Any defects that could affect the final appearance need to be addressed before gilding begins.
Base Preparation
Depending on the chosen technique and substrate, suitable primers, grounds, gesso, bole or sizing systems may be used.
Gold Leaf Application
Individual sheets of gold leaf are carefully applied by hand. This requires controlled handling and considerable precision.
Finishing
The finished surface may be gently burnished, protected or treated according to the type of gilding and the requirements of the project.
Inspection
The completed work is inspected to ensure consistency, clean detailing and a finish that complements the surrounding architecture.
